He provides leadership and support across … tts group tychyWitryna6 lip 2024 · According to data released today from UNAIDS and WHO, new HIV infections fell by 39% between 2000 and 2024. HIV-related deaths fell by 51% over the same time period, and some 15 million lives were saved through the use of antiretroviral therapy. However, progresstowards global targets is stalling.
